So here you go, a day in the life of Gabriella:

Between 7am & 7:30- She wakes up. (I actually set my alarm & wake up anywhere between 5am & 6am- depending on how much work I need to get done.) We bring her downstairs, and play with her for a bit before feeding her breakfast.

Aviary Photo_130178659938548950

This morning happened to be a little bit of oatmeal, fruit and homemade baby pancakes. (recipe to come!)

Aviary Photo_130178660484109495

I feed her after Craig leaves for work (around 7:45am) and we watch a bit of the Today Show before heading out for my morning run.

Most days I will nurse her around 7:45am/ 8am before I run, to top off her little tank. (& also for some relief- ha! Nothing like running full of milk. Winking smile )

8am – 10am/ 10:30am : We run, well, I run and Gabriella naps.

She will usually fall asleep about 30 minutes into my run, and then I will run anywhere from an hour and a half to two hours- just depends on if I am doing a long run, speed work, or an easier run day. I typically run at least 8 miles a day, and once I finish my run I will walk until Gabriella wakes up. (& to cool down) Once she is up, we head to the park.

Between 6pm & 6:30pm: Dinner time for Gabriella!

We decided to try giving her pasta (you just over cook it, so that it’s almost mush), and she liked it!

IMG_6970

IMG_6971

She wasn’t quite sure what to do with it, she kind of played with it for a while but eventually figured out that it was for her to eat. She also had some sweet potatoes and apples. Girlfriend has quite an appetite. I say she gets it from her Daddy! Smile

Oh, and you may wonder why she is suddenly without clothes…well, we strip her down when it’s feeding time. – Meal and snack time. Just because she is very messy, as all babies are, and sometimes the food will stain her clothes even AFTER using stain removers and letting the clothes soak. (Mom’s out there: have you found a stain remover that really does remove stains entirely?)

Between 7pm & 8pm: Bath time, and then I nurse her to bed.

Since we have been sleep training, and it’s been going pretty well (I say that with caution because every time I’ve mentioned something about her sleeping better, she has a WILD night.) and she is also getting up to eat once- around 3am/ 4am. She may cry or fuss for a bit around midnight, but we just let her cry & it’s REALLY short and she puts herself back to sleep. Thankfully.
